Common Signs You May Need Radiator Repair
Cooling system issues can lead to engine damage. Watch for:
- Engine temperature running high
- Coolant leaks under the vehicle
- Low coolant warning light
- Sweet smell from the engine bay
- Visible rust or damage on radiator

How Radiator Repair Is Typically Handled Locally
Local specialists typically begin with cooling system pressure test, leak detection, and radiator inspection. Based on Brampton's driving conditions, technicians also focus on:
Radiator fin damage from road salt and pothole debris impact
Coolant condition, concentration, and freeze point protection year-round
Radiator pressure cap and seal integrity preventing overheating and leaks

Heavy traffic gridlock prevents adequate airflow cooling. Engines generate maximum heat during constant acceleration and braking. AC compressor creates additional engine load. Cooling system efficiency must be verified regularly to handle Brampton's traffic stress.
Road salt spray corrodes radiator aluminum fins and tubes, reducing cooling efficiency. It also contaminates coolant, causing internal corrosion. Regular radiator flushing every 24 months and using premium coolant with corrosion inhibitors is essential.
Yes, use OEM-approved extended-life coolant rated for extreme temperature swings (-20°C to 28°C+). Ensure proper 50/50 concentration for freeze/boil protection. Have coolant flushed and replaced every 24-30 months to prevent corrosion and degradation.
